At Bridgend Train Station, purchasing tickets is straightforward and convenient. The ticket office welcomes you every day from 05:45 to 19:00, ensuring you have ample time to secure your travel documents. If you're short on time, no worries—ticket machines are available, complete with accessible options. These machines accept major credit cards and cash, and offer facilities to collect tickets purchased online. If you're traveling with a smartcard, validators are ready to assist you.
The station prides itself on being highly accessible, with step-free access throughout and lifts connecting all platforms. Waiting rooms are available from 06:00 to 21:30, and accessible toilets on Platform 1 ensure comfort for all passengers. Additionally, you can expect attentive service from the welcoming station staff, who are on hand from 06:00 until 22:00 and ready to offer assistance whenever needed.
One of the highlights of Bridgend Train Station is its seamless connectivity to various transport options. A Rail Replacement service awaits at the station's front, ensuring you're well-covered during disruptions. The taxi rank at the station's entrance offers a convenient option for those looking to travel by cab. Furthermore, if you're planning to explore Bridgend's charming streets, consider purchasing a PlusBus ticket for unlimited discounted bus travel.
While the station doesn't offer on-site cycle hire, it provides generous bicycle storage including stands on Platform 1 and Platform 2 for those cycling to the station. This makes transitioning between riding and rail travel a breeze.

Morpeth Train Station is equipped to meet the needs of any traveler. Open from Monday to Friday between 06:30 and 17:30, and Saturdays until 13:00, the ticket office provides ample opportunity for purchasing tickets. For convenience, ticket machines are available and include features to aid accessibility. The station supports smartcard issuance and allows for online ticket collection, although it’s worth noting that there aren’t any smartcard validators at the site.
Travelers requiring assistance can benefit from a variety of services. Staff assistance is available during ticket office hours or via a helpline outside these times. The station features step-free access, ensuring easy navigation for all passengers, and additional amenities such as an induction loop and ramp access to trains cater to enhanced mobility needs. Unfortunately, facilities such as waiting rooms and refreshment conveniences are lacking, with no accessible toilets or lounge areas.
When it comes to onward travel, Morpeth Train Station does not disappoint. With a taxi rank located next to the booking office, getting to your next destination is straightforward. Should you prefer public transport, there’s a bus service with a convenient turning point by platform 1. Rail replacement services are also accessible from the station front, providing additional peace of mind should you need it. While cycle hire is not available directly at the station, those who bring their bicycles can use the secure cycle facilities provided.
